Using a calculator or a computer program, the square root of pi can be calculated to a high degree of accuracy. However, the value remains an irrational number, meaning it cannot be expressed as a finite decimal or fraction.
So, what is the square root of pi, and how is it calculated? In simple terms, the square root of a number is a value that, when multiplied by itself, gives the original number. In the case of pi, which is approximately 3.14159, the square root would be a number that, when multiplied by itself, equals pi. This value is often denoted as √π.
